The newly revised pricing structure reflects a shift toward AI-driven productivity. Small business owners can expect significant benefits from the enhanced AI functionalities and streamlined integrations. For example, all paid plans will gain features like summarization and huddle notes, with the Business+ plan receiving advanced options for workflow generation, recaps, and translations. A new Enterprise+ plan offers robust enterprise search and sophisticated task management capabilities, which could be game-changers for organizations looking to improve operational efficiency.
One of the standout features is the availability of Salesforce Channels, which allows organizations to collaborate seamlessly around customer data. Every Salesforce customer will automatically receive a free Slack plan with access to essential integrations. Security remains a critical concern for all businesses, and Slack has addressed this by enhancing protective measures across all plans. New features such as session duration controls and native device management ensure that sensitive data remains secure. Additionally, SAML-based single sign-on (SSO) now supports Salesforce users, reinforcing Slack’s emphasis on secure collaboration.
However, there are potential challenges to consider. Pricing for the Business+ plan will increase from $12.50 to $15 per user per month to accommodate the new AI features. While this might initially concern budget-conscious small business owners, the extensive suite of tools could justify the cost by boosting productivity and allowing teams to operate more effectively.
